Selected Indicators | Definition |
EBITDA | Earnings before net interest and financial expenses, income taxes, depreciation and amortization. |
ΕΒΙΤDA Margin | It is calculated as the ratio of Earnings before net interest and financial expenses, income taxes, depreciation and amortization to total revenue. |
RASK (Revenue per Available Seat Kilometer) | It is calculated as the ratio of the revenue from contracts with customers to the total available seats multiplied by the total kilometers covered. |
CASK (Cost per Available Seat Kilometer) | It is calculated as the ratio of the total expenses to the total available seats multiplied by the total kilometers covered. |
CASK (Cost per Available Seat Kilometer) excluding fuel cost | It is calculated as the ratio of the total expenses minus the fuel cost to the total available seats multiplied by the total kilometers covered. |
Passenger Yield | It is calculated as the ratio revenue from contracts with customers to total passengers multiplied by the total kilometers covered. |
Load Factor | It is calculated as the passenger kilometers (RPK) to the available seat kilometers (ASK) for scheduled flights. RPK’s is the number of revenues passengers carried multiplied by the distance flown in kilometers. |

Climate change mitigation | Material impact or risk | Substantiation and actions |
Negative actual & potential impact (Value chain) | Release of GHG emissions (Scope 3) emissions through aviation manufacturing, distribution of raw materials, fuels, consumables and aircraft maintenance activities. | Supply chain emissions -mainly from Tier 1 suppliers- relating to aircraft and engines manufacturing, fuel and energy-related activities (fuel suppliers), production and distribution of raw material and aircraft consumables, as well as aircraft maintenance (MRO) business. The Group responds to this impact through actions to decarbonize the value chain, promoting constant discussions with group’s partners about new technologies and opportunities emerged. |
Negative actual and potential impact (Own operations) | Release of GHG emissions (Scope 1, 2) through business operation. | GHG emissions released through Group's business activities - air transportation, ground handling services, aircraft maintenance & technical support. The Group responds to this impact through decarbonization actions of own operations. |
Negative actual & potential impact (Value chain) | Pollution of air through the release of non-GHG emissions. | Upstream: Pollution of air through the release of non-GHG emissions (i.e. NOx, particulates from fossil fuel combustion) during production, logistics and distribution activities (i.e. raw materials, fuels). Downstream: Pollution of air through the release of non-GHG emissions (i.e. particulates from conventional fuel combustion) due to passengers' transportation (i.e vehicles to and from the airport) and due to waste management operational activities. The Group responds to this impact through actions to decarbonize the value chain, promoting constant discussions with group’s partners about new technologies and opportunities emerged. |
Negative actual & potential impact (Own operations) | Pollution of air through the release of non-GHG emissions in flight activity. | Pollution of air through the release non-GHG emissions (i.e. NOx, SOx) produced by aircrafts contrails during flights. Aircraft engines emit gases (i.e. NOX, particulates from fossil fuel combustion), which interact with the atmosphere, leading to air pollution, impacting surface-level ozone and fine particulate matter (PM 2.5) and affect human health and air quality. The Group responds to this impact through decarbonization actions of own operations. |
Positive actual & potential impact (Own operations) | Actions to reduce greenhouse gas emissions | Group invests in fleet renewal with new engine technology aircraft and implements route optimization processes as well as fuel saving practices. At the same time, the Company implements a Sustainable Aviation Fuels (SAF) program, by uplifting SAF on flights departing from certain airports. |
Positive actual & potential impact (Own operations) | Air pollution prevention | Group invests in fleet renewal with new engine technology aircraft, which contributes to the reduction of non-GHG emissions per flight and per passenger. |
Climate change adaptation | Material impact or risk | Substantiation and actions |
Potential risk (Own operations) | Climate-related transition risk | The climate transition of the aviation sector also poses risks from the immediate implementation of the decarbonization process, given that the sector relies on the use of fossil fuels (hard-to-abate sector) for its operation (unexpected decarbonization transition cost). Measures promoted by the European Union (EU) aiming to reducing carbon dioxide emissions in aviation sector, have been assessed mainly from an environmental point of view and without considering proportionately their overall impact on tourism activity and, by extension, on the competitiveness of economies highly dependent on tourism. |
Potential risk (Own operations) | Climate-related physical risk | Acute: Potential risk due to climate change that may directly affect the Group and/or the wider "ecosystem", such as airports or other infrastructure. Cost associated to delays and/or idle hours/days due to extreme weather conditions. Chronic: Potential higher operational costs to adopt technological developments aiming to respond to increased mid-temperature. |

Hellenic Corporate Governance Code | Explanation / Justification of the deviations from the specific practices of the Greek Corporate Governance Code |
Diversity Criteria
Special Practice 2.2.15
| Other than the members of the Board of Directors for the selections of which the company applies the foreseen in the Suitability Policy of the members of the Board of Directors diversity criteria, there are no explicit diversity criteria concerning senior management with specific gender representation objectives as well as timetables for achieving them. The company considers a timetable for the adoption of suitable diversity criteria for senior and senior management, while accessing that extra time is going to be needed so that their entactment and implementation can be made feasible, taking into consideration the nature of the Company’s activities. It is estimated that there is no risk from the above deviation, for as long as it is in force. |
Composition of Board of Directors Special Practice 2.2.21 Special Practice 2.2.22 | The Board of Directors does not appoint as an independent non-executive Vice-Chairman or a senior independent member one of its independent non-executive members, as this practice has the prerequisite of the Chairman of Board being a non-executive member. In accordance with the provisions of the article 8 paragraph 2 of L.4706/2020, the Board of Directors has appointed as Chairman of the Board one of its executive members and also one of its non-executive members as the Vice-President. In this context, the Board of Directors has appointed two (2) Vice-Presidents non-executive as members of the Board of Directors. The Vice Chairman Α΄ may substitute the competences of the Chairman of the Board, as stated on the statutes of the Company, when he is unable to attend or impediment. In case of absence or impediment from the Vice Chairman A’, he is substituted by Vice Chairman B’. The said composition ensures the Board’s efficient and productive operation. After the expiration of the Boards mandate, the company will review where it is deliberate and feasible to fully comply with the above Special Practice. |

Hellenic Corporate Governance Code | Explanation / Justification of the deviations from the specific practices of the Greek Corporate Governance Code |
Remuneration of members of the Board of Directors Special Practice 2.4.14
| There is no specific provision in the contractual terms for all executive members of the Board of Directors in which is envisaged, that the Board of Directors may require the refund of all, or part of the bonus awarded, due to breach of contractual terms or incorrect financial statements of previous years or generally based on incorrect financial data, used for the calculation of this bonus. In order to fully comply with this Special Practice, the Company examines the amendment of the contracts with the addition of explicit terms for the above and accesses that extra time will be needed. It is estimated that there is no risk from the above deviation, for as long as it is in force. Besides that, according to the remuneration policy for the Members of the Board of Directors, the payment for variable remuneration can be postponed with the decision of the BoD, especially if there are special circumstances that justify this postponement (i.e. the profitability of the company has been affected from an unpredictable event), while the payment of the bonus can be recalled with a decision from the Board of Directors, if the member has been sentenced or the elements of the company’s profitability based on the published financial statements are proved to be inaccurate. |

Siskos Panagiotis | Accountable Manager He graduated from the Pilot Department of the Hellenic Air Force Academy in 1981 and obtained a Master's degree in Public Management from Midwestern State University in Texas. He served a total of 22 years in the Hellenic Air Force, initially as a Flight Instructor T-38 at the EURO-NATO Joint Jet Pilot Training in the USA and as a Flight Instructor T-2 at the Advanced-Operational Jet Training of the Hellenic Air Force Academy, then as a F-5 Operational Pilot and Mirage 2000 Pilot / Instructor, Operations Officer, Squadron Commander as well as a Section Chief at the Hellenic Air Force General Staff. Since 1999, he has flown in Civil Aviation and is a Captain and Instructor on Airbus 320 aircraft, with over 13,500 flight hours in total. |
Michail Kouveliotis | Deputy CEO & Chief Financial Officer He graduated from Athens University of Economics and Business in 1987. He works for 33 years in the Vassilakis Group, for 6 years he was the Financial Director of TECHNOCAR SA. He holds the position of Deputy CEO & Chief Financial Officer of the Company since 2003. He is Chairman of the Board of Directors and CEO of Olympic Air. He is also a member of the Board of Directors of Aegean Executive S.A. and a member of the Sustainability Development Committee of the Company. |
Roland Jaggi | Chief Commercial Officer He started his airline career 1994 at Swissair. After 12 years in various roles at headquarters in Zurich, in Russia and in Portugal, he moved to Athens in 2006 to join Aegean Airlines to build the Revenue Management and Pricing capability. Over the years his responsibilities expanded, since 2018 he is leading the entire Commercial Organization of Aegean Airlines. |
Panagiotis Nikolaidis
| Chief Ground Operations Officer He has an overall airline experience of over 30 years and has been working for Aegean Airlines Ground Operations for the last 26 years, starting as Station Manager, Airport Services Manager, Ground Operations Director. His responsibilities cover all Airports (more than 150 stations domestic and international), Call Center, Customer Relations and Customer Care Center.
He served as a member of IATA Aviation Ground Services Agreements Task Force (AGSA) until 2021 and as a member of IATA Ground Operations Group (GOG) until 2023 and he participates in the Star Alliance Customer Experience Strategy Group since 2014. |
Aristidis Kamvysis | Chief Information Officer Mr. Kamvysis studied in the UK, earning a B.Sc. in Computer Science from Leeds University (1992) and an M.Sc. in Virtual Reality, from Hull University (1993). During his studies, he worked for a year in Paris, with Air Inter. Prior joining Aegean, he worked in carious with Greek companies. From 1995 to 1997 he worked at Attica Bank, in the IT Department. From 1997 to 1999, he worked in the IT Department, at Athens International Airport. He joined Aegean Airlines in 1999. |
Ioannis Aloukos
| Technical Director He is an Aeronautical Engineer holding a Beng in Aerospace Engineering and an MSc in Advanced Manufacturing. He is a member of Technical Chamber. During his 14-year career in Aegean he has worked in Quality Unit as a Quality Auditor, holding managerial positions in various Technical Department sections such as Workshops and Base Maintenance. He is the Technical Director since September of 2020. |
Marios E. Menexiadis | Internal Audit Director He is an economist specializing in Internal Audit. He holds a Postdoc and PhD in Internal Auditing and Best Practices from the National and Kapodistrian University of Athens, an MSc in Internal Auditing from City University and a Macc in International Accounting and Financial Management from Glasgow University. In parallel, he is certified FCPA, CPIA, CRCO, COSO-ERM, certified in governance, risk management and compliance G.R.C. by the International Compliance Association. He is the Vice President of the Association of Certified Public Accountants International, while for a number of years he has been the Internal Audit Director of PLCs groups in the Athens Stock Exchange. Prior to joining the airline industry in 2009, he served as an Internal Audit Director in the chemical as well as the in the food and beverage industry. His professional career started at the “Big 5” (Andersen & PwC), while at the same time he has served as a Member of the Audit Committee of the Hellenic Institute of Internal Auditors. |

Revenue recognition and loyalty programs liability (separate and consolidated financial statements) | |
See Notes 2.2, 2.4, 3.21 and 3.24 to the Separate and Consolidated Financial Statements. | |
The key audit matter | How the matter was addressed in our audit |
Revenue from contracts with customers for the Company and the Group amounted to EUR 1 719 million and EUR 1 777 million respectively for the year ended 31 December 2024 and mainly relate to sales of flight tickets. Flight ticket sales represent the main revenue source and comprise direct ticket sales, ticket sales through agents and interline ticket sales. Revenue from flight ticket sales is accounted for as flown and at year-end a contract liability is recognized for the non-flown tickets as the service has not yet been provided. This amount is subsequently recognized as revenue when the flight takes place. Relevant total liabilities from tickets sold but non-flown and credit voucher as of 31 December 2024 amounted to EUR 229 million and EUR 230 million for the Company and the Group respectively. | Regarding this matter, our audit procedures included, among others, the following:
|
In addition, the Company and the Group have established a loyalty program that is treated as a separate component of the sales transaction resulting in a portion of revenue from the flight ticket sales to be recognized in subsequent periods, upon redemption of the miles earned by customers when the performance obligation is fulfilled. The management makes judgements, estimates and assumptions with a high degree of uncertainty and uses actuarial methods and historical data and information for the quantification of the fair value of the miles offered to customers and the percentage of miles which are not expected to be redeemed. Relevant contract liabilities as of 31 December 2024 amounted to EUR 63 million for the Company and the Group respectively. We identified the revenue recognition and contract liabilities as a key audit matter due to the size of the related amounts, the complexity associated with the volume of transactions which are processed in various IT systems, the inherent risk of not recognizing revenues in the correct period and due to the estimates, assumptions and judgments used by the management for the calculation of the related amounts. |
• For a sample of direct sales we tested the accuracy of the amount of revenue recognized and we confirmed the proper recording of their status in the system (flown/not flown). • For sales through agents, we received the monthly sales analysis per country from the commercial system and we audited the reconciliation of the accounts involved to general ledger. For a sample of sales through agents, we audited the reconciliation of the reports from International Air Transport Association (IATA) that contain information of basic fare, VAT and taxes to the relevant accounts involved to general ledger. • For a sample of receivables from agents we reviewed the collections took place subsequent to year end. • For a sample of interline revenue, we received the clearances by International Air Transport Association (IATA) and we audited the reconciliation to the revenue accounts in the general ledger. • For a sample of not flown tickets as at 31 December 2024, we confirmed that they were properly recorded as contract liability. • We have audited the passenger breakage revenue. We have evaluated the methodology applied by management in accordance with IFRS and the assumptions applied by management that relate to the pattern of rights exercised by the passengers based on historical information. |

Provision for aircraft maintenance (separate and consolidated financial statements) | |
See Notes 2.2 and 3.19 to the Separate and Consolidated Financial Statements. | |
Provision for aircraft maintenance for the Company and the Group amounted to EUR 187 million and EUR 193 million respectively for the year ended 31 December 2024. The Company and the Group operate aircrafts under lease agreements based on which certain maintenance requirements have to be met. During the contract period, a provision is made with the estimated amounts required to be paid in the future for the fulfilment of the contractual commitments. There is a high degree of uncertainty in the judgements, estimates and assumptions made by management, that may affect the provision for aircraft maintenance. We identified the provision for aircraft maintenance as a key audit matter due to the size of the related accounts and due to the judgements, estimates and assumptions used by the management for the calculation of the related amounts. | Regarding this matter, our audit procedures included, among others, the following:
